Second Stage Round 2: RC Celta - Gran Canaria 66-58
Date: April 27, 2018
First defeat of league's leader Gran Canaria (1-1) against Real Celta Vigo (2-0) 66-58 was the most important game of the last round. The game without a history. Real Celta Vigo led from the first minutes and controlled entire game increasing their lead in each quarter. They held Gran Canaria to an opponent 22.9 percent shooting from the field compared to 36.2 percent accuracy of the winners. Mali center Minata Keita (190-89) orchestrated the victory with a double-double by scoring 14 points and 16 rebounds. American-Nigerian guard Sarah Ogoke (178-90, college: So.Poly State) contributed with 7 points, 12 rebounds and 4 assists for the winners. American guard Erica Covile (185, college: Temple) replied with a double-double by scoring 13 points and 18 rebounds and her fellow American import point guard Starr Breedlove (168-93, college: UTEP) added 12 points, 6 rebounds and 4 assists in the effort for Gran Canaria. Gran Canaria will play next round against strong GDKO Bizkaia trying to make it back to the top of the standings. Real Celta Vigo will try to continue on its current victory against Adelantados in San Cristobal.
